Transaction 754683e1d6637c83ecc70e1482f28fc86a11b36fc6f604c57adde866502067ac
1 Input
1 Output
-
754683e1d6637c83ecc70e1482f28fc86a11b36fc6f604c57adde866502067ac:0
- value
- 1028775
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5d830dd751ba88d2dd0a7844f08c305c4b0593c OP_EQUAL
- address
- 3Kj82YGiSd8f3Yqx4azgzH5wZ724FASRrA